Average Wiring Upgrades Cost Breakdown
Complete home rewiring projects in NYC involve multiple cost components that contribute to final pricing. Understanding these elements helps property owners anticipate total expenses and identify potential savings opportunities.
Labor typically represents 40-60% of total wiring upgrades cost, ranging from $65-150 per hour depending on electrician expertise and project complexity. NYC electricians command premium rates due to high living costs, licensing requirements, and building access challenges.
Materials including copper wire, outlet boxes, switches, breakers, and junction boxes account for 25-35% of project costs. Wire gauge selection, outlet quantity, and circuit requirements significantly impact material expenses.
Permit fees range from $300-1,200 depending on project scope and borough requirements. Manhattan and Brooklyn typically charge higher permit costs than outer boroughs due to stricter inspection protocols and administrative expenses.
Complete Home Rewiring Costs
| Home Size | Square Footage | Average Cost Range | Timeline |
|---|---|---|---|
| Small Apartment | 500-800 sq ft | $8,000-$10,000 | 3-4 days |
| Medium Home | 1,000-1,500 sq ft | $10,000-$13,000 | 4-6 days |
| Large Home | 1,800-2,500 sq ft | $13,000-$18,000 | 6-8 days |
| Multi-Family | 3,000+ sq ft | $18,000-$25,000+ | 8-12 days |
Complete rewiring involves removing outdated wiring systems and installing modern copper wiring throughout properties. These projects address safety concerns while increasing electrical capacity for modern appliances and technology.
Homes built before 1980 often require complete rewiring due to deteriorated insulation, inadequate capacity, and outdated safety standards. Old wiring poses fire risks that justify complete replacement costs through enhanced safety and reliability.
Partial Wiring Upgrade Expenses
Partial upgrades focus on specific areas or circuits requiring immediate attention without complete system replacement. These targeted projects cost significantly less than whole-house rewiring while addressing critical safety concerns.
Kitchen rewiring ranges from $2,500-$5,000 depending on appliance quantity and circuit requirements. Modern kitchens need dedicated circuits for refrigerators, dishwashers, microwaves, and small appliance outlets.
Basement electrical upgrades cost $1,500-$4,000 including new circuits, lighting, and outlet installations. Finished basements require extensive wiring to support living spaces, entertainment systems, and home offices.
Bedroom and bathroom rewiring typically costs $1,000-$2,500 per room depending on outlet quantity, lighting complexity, and fixture installations. Bathrooms require GFCI protection adding to material and labor expenses.
Factors Affecting Wiring Upgrades Cost
Several variables significantly influence final wiring upgrade pricing beyond basic square footage calculations:
Building Age and Construction
Older buildings with plaster walls require more careful installation techniques that increase labor costs. Modern drywall construction allows easier wire access and faster installation.
Wire Type and Gauge Requirements
Copper wiring costs more than aluminum but provides superior safety and longevity. Heavy-gauge wire for high-power circuits increases material expenses proportionally.
Accessibility Challenges
Multi-story homes require additional labor for vertical wire runs. Finished walls necessitate careful patching and potential painting after installation completion.
Code Compliance Requirements
NYC electrical codes mandate GFCI outlets in wet areas and AFCI protection for living spaces. These safety features add $150-300 per circuit to installation costs.

Additional Expenses to Consider
Several ancillary costs beyond basic wiring installation affect total project expenses:
- Electrical Panel Upgrades Most rewiring projects require panel upgrades to support increased capacity. Panel upgrade costs range from $2,500-$6,000 depending on amperage requirements and service entrance modifications.
- Wall Repair and Painting Access holes for wire installation require patching, sanding, and painting. Budget $500-$2,000 for cosmetic restoration depending on damage extent.
- Asbestos Remediation Pre-1980 homes may contain asbestos insulation requiring special handling. Remediation costs add $1,000-$3,000 to project expenses.

Permit and Inspection Process
NYC wiring upgrades require proper permits and inspections that affect project timelines and costs:
Permit applications include detailed project plans, material specifications, and contractor licensing information. Approval typically takes 1-2 weeks depending on borough and project complexity.
Electrical inspections occur at rough-in stage before covering wires and at final completion. Inspectors verify code compliance, proper installation techniques, and safety feature implementation.
Failed inspections require corrections and re-inspection fees adding to project costs and timelines. Professional contractors familiar with local codes minimize inspection complications.

Timeline Expectations
Understanding project duration helps property owners plan appropriately for wiring upgrade disruptions:
| Project Scope | Duration | Power Interruption |
|---|---|---|
| Single Room | 1-2 days | Partial, 4-6 hours |
| Multiple Rooms | 3-5 days | Partial, 6-8 hours daily |
| Complete Rewiring | 5-10 days | Intermittent throughout |
| Commercial Space | 10-20 days | Scheduled outages |
Professional contractors work efficiently to minimize disruption while ensuring quality installations. They coordinate work schedules to preserve essential services like refrigeration and heating.
